    Sara Cox’s Children in Need challenge explained: The route, map and all the timings

    Team_Prime US NewsBy Team_Prime US NewsNovember 11, 2025No Comments3 Mins Read
    Share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Reddit Telegram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email


    The Radio 2 star and TV character began her quest on Monday (November 10) within the 5 day mission which she has vowed to complete even when she is “weeping”.

    BBC

    Cox will cowl the 135 miles on foot across four counties – Northumberland, Durham, North Yorkshire and West Yorkshire – protecting a distance of 5 marathons throughout 5 days and stated: “We’re speaking 135 miles of hills, moors and blisters – however I’m prepared for the problem, and I’ll completely be giving it all the things I’ve obtained.

    “Once they picked me to get Pudsey to Pudsey, I used to be honoured & horrified in equal measure.

    “Similar to with Vernon and Paddy, I do know the sensible Radio 2 listeners will likely be with me each step of the best way, and their encouragement and assist will shove me up each incline and pull me by way of my hardest moments.

    Pudsey Bear and BBC Radio 2 presenter Sara Cox (BBC Radio 2/PA)

    “Pudsey has been a part of Children in Need for 40 years this yr, and I can’t consider a greater method to rejoice than by serving to increase much-needed funds for youngsters who want it most.”

    The problem marks Radio 2’s longest problem by way of days.

    Right here is all we all know in regards to the epic check of stamina:

    What’s the route Sara is taking?

    Cox began the hunt on Monday (November 10) within the Kielder Forest close to the Scottish Borders, and is predicted to complete the complete problem in Pudsey, Leeds on Friday (November 14).

    From Scotland, she yesterday went by way of Northumberland Nationwide Park, earlier than then following the River North Tyne by way of the small villages of Bellingham, Wark and Humshaugh, earlier than crossing Hadrian’s Wall.

    On Tuesday the plan is for her to go away Hexham, passing by way of Corbridge and different small cities alongside the River Tyne earlier than ending the day in Durham.

    Sara Cox will journey 135 miles within the problem

    BBC

    Day three will see Cox enter North Yorkshire and end out there city of Northallerton, a gateway to the Yorkshire Dales.

    On day 4, Cox will run by way of Northallerton to Harrogate and on the ultimate day will go away Harrogate, passing by way of smaller cities comparable to Otley and Headingley earlier than heading on rural roads into West Yorkshire and ending in Pudsey, Leeds – the house of Pudsey Bear.
